Trump’s Comments on Jeffries Highlight Tensions Over Supreme Court’s Voting Rights Ruling
In a recent development that underscores the existing political friction surrounding the Supreme Court’s interpretation of the Voting Rights Act, former President Donald Trump has publicly criticized House Minority Leader Hakeem Jeffries. Trump’s comments come in the wake of Jeffries’ reaction to a Supreme Court decision, which he described as rendering the court ‘illegitimate.’
Trump’s Remarks and the Political Repercussions
The former president, known for his combative rhetoric, took to social media to question whether Jeffries should face impeachment for his criticism of the Supreme Court. Trump’s assertion, while lacking a constitutional basis, reflects the heightened political tensions as both parties navigate the implications of the court’s decisions on voting rights.
Jeffries, a prominent Democrat, has been vocal about his concerns regarding the Supreme Court’s recent rulings, which he believes undermine the integrity of voting rights protections. Trump’s response, branding Jeffries as a “Low IQ individual” and suggesting impeachment, appears to be an attempt to rally his base by casting doubt on Democratic leadership.
The Broader Context of Supreme Court Decisions
The Supreme Court’s handling of voting rights has been a contentious issue, with many Democrats arguing that recent decisions threaten to weaken measures designed to ensure fair and equitable voting processes. The court’s rulings have sparked debate over the balance between state and federal oversight in election laws, a topic that has gained prominence amid ongoing discussions about electoral integrity and access.
Jeffries’ comments highlight a growing concern among Democrats that the court is increasingly aligning with conservative perspectives, potentially at the expense of minority voters. This sentiment is echoed by various advocacy groups who argue that recent decisions could lead to disenfranchisement.
